The Psychology of Time Limits

Setting strict time limits prevents emotional betting. The longer you play, the more your judgment becomes clouded by fatigue or chasing losses. Experts recommend 45-minute sessions with mandatory breaks. This keeps your decisions sharp and your bankroll intact.

The One-Hour Rule

Never play longer than 60 minutes without a pause. Use a timer. Step away, hydrate, and review your wins and losses. This simple habit prevents the “just one more spin” trap.
